    You would need the paid CSS upgrade and some CSS editing experience to hide the categories at the bottom.

    With OceanMist, the post titles and metadata at the top have a bluish background by design. I’m not sure why your home PC would be showing it as white although all computers will render colors slightly differently, and some computer video cards are way off.

    To hide the categories and tags at the bottom of each post copy the code below into your CSS, you can preview the changes before deciding on paying for the upgrade:

    .post .postinfo p {visibility:hidden; height:0;}
    .post .postinfo p.com {visibility:visible;}

    I think they are wanting to remove them from the far bottom of the page (bottom widget area) which would take this

    .catlist {display: none; }

    I never figured out how to get rid of the categories title and background since it uses .title h2 and .title just like the posts do.

  • Unknown's avatar

    Child selector to the rescue:

    .catlist, #content>.title {display:none;}
